The safety protective helmet market is experiencing steady growth as industries, governments, and consumers place increasing emphasis on head protection and workplace safety. Safety protective helmets are designed to safeguard users from impact, falling objects, electrical hazards, and other head-related risks. These helmets are widely used in construction, manufacturing, mining, oil and gas, transportation, and sports-related activities. Growing awareness of occupational hazards and stricter safety regulations are making protective helmets a mandatory requirement across many sectors.

As infrastructure development and industrial expansion continue worldwide, demand for reliable and certified safety helmets is rising. Employers are prioritizing worker safety not only to meet compliance standards but also to reduce accident-related costs and improve workforce productivity.

Key Drivers Fueling Market Growth

One of the main drivers of the safety protective helmet market is the enforcement of occupational safety regulations. Governments and regulatory bodies require the use of certified protective equipment in hazardous work environments. Construction sites, factories, and industrial facilities increasingly enforce helmet usage to minimize the risk of head injuries and fatalities.

Rapid growth in construction and infrastructure projects is also boosting market demand. Urbanization, transportation development, and energy projects create large-scale employment in high-risk environments where safety helmets are essential. Similarly, expansion in mining and oil and gas exploration continues to support steady helmet demand.

Another important growth factor is rising awareness of personal safety among workers and employers. Training programs, safety audits, and insurance requirements are encouraging companies to invest in high-quality protective helmets rather than basic alternatives.

Product Innovation and Technological Advancements

Technological innovation is shaping competition in the safety protective helmet market. Manufacturers are introducing lightweight materials, improved shock absorption systems, and enhanced ventilation designs to improve comfort and usability. Modern helmets are made using advanced plastics, composites, and fiber-reinforced materials that provide strong protection while reducing weight.

Smart helmet technology is emerging as a notable trend. Some safety helmets now feature integrated sensors, communication systems, GPS tracking, and impact detection. These smart features enable real-time monitoring of worker location, accident alerts, and safety compliance, especially in mining, construction, and industrial environments.

Design improvements are also focused on ergonomics and fit. Adjustable suspension systems, sweat-resistant padding, and improved airflow help increase worker acceptance and encourage consistent helmet usage throughout long work shifts.

Market Segmentation and Application Areas

The safety protective helmet market can be segmented by type, application, and end user. By type, hard hats dominate the market, especially in construction and industrial sectors. Helmets designed for electrical protection, high-impact resistance, and specialized industrial tasks are also widely used.

In terms of application, construction remains the largest segment due to constant exposure to falling objects and structural hazards. Manufacturing and industrial facilities represent another significant segment, where helmets protect workers from machinery-related risks. Mining, oil and gas, and transportation sectors also contribute substantially to overall demand.

Sports and recreational activities form a growing segment as awareness of head injury prevention increases. Helmets used in cycling, climbing, and other activities are benefiting from improvements in safety standards and design aesthetics.
